Sojourner Truth (born Isabella Belle Baumfree; c. 1797 - 1883) was an American abolitionist and women’s rights activist. She became the first black woman to win such a case against a white man. In 2014, Truth was included in Smithsonian magazine’s list of the 100 Most Significant Americans of All Time .
